404 - Might there be something wrong with my permissions?

Hello Tomcat-experts!
I have recently bought some space at a webhotel that uses Apache HTTP server as front before a Tomcat 6.0.37.My account at the webhotel is said to support Struts and Hibernate and such technics.At home I have developed a app that uses those technics and of course it runs fine in a similar environment as the one at the webhotel. I can deploy my app as a ROOT-app or a ordinary app and the Struts works perfectly.
At the webhotel I have tried to deploy it booth as a ROOT-app and as a MYAPP-webapp-1.0.0.war-file
Now I have stripped the app down to just a struts2-hello-world-app.
But at the webhotel I just keep getting this when I try to access the ActionClass through struts.xml:
HTTP Status 404 - There is no Action mapped for namespace [/] and action name [welcome] associated with context path [/MYAPP-webapp-1.0.0].type Status reportmessage There is no Action mapped for namespace [/] and action name [welcome] associated with context path [/MYAPP-webapp-1.0.0].description The requested resource is not available.
Unfortenatly the support guys at the webhotel says they lack knowledge of Tomcat so they can not help me out.But today I at least found this exception in the catalina.log just after my attempt yo access a struts-path:

I'm pretty sure this exception come from me. So perhaps the webhotel-admin guys has set upp my rights incorrect?
For a couple of weeks I have struggle to test different apache-mapping, context.xml and struts-namespace-settings. At home it work but not at the webhotel. Even though I start to think that it might not has anything to do with this I just add some info below about my settings:
Apache-mappings (that I have set at the webhotel):/*.jsp /*.jspx /*.jsf /servlet/* /*.do /MYAPP-webapp-1.0.0/* /*
(At home I just got: JkMount  /* worker1)
Context.xml (from inside the MYAPP-webapp-1.0.0.war)<Context path="" override="true" />
In my struts.xml I got this snippet:	<package name="basicstruts2" namespace="" extends="struts-default">			<action name="login">		    <result type="dispatcher">/login.jsp</result>		</action>
		<action name="welcome" class="se.MYAPP.web.actions.WelcomeUserAction">			<result name="SUCCESS" type="dispatcher">/welcome.jsp</result>		</action>            	</package>
In my web.xml I got this snippet:	<filter>		<filter-name>struts2</filter-name>		<filter-class>org.apache.struts2.dispatcher.ng.filter.StrutsPrepareAndExecuteFilter</filter-class>	</filter>
	<filter-mapping>		<filter-name>struts2</filter-name>		<url-pattern>/*</url-pattern>	</filter-mapping>	But if I try to access the struts paths like:http://www.MYAPP.se/MYAPP-webapp-1.0.0/loginhttp://www.MYAPP.se/MYAPP-webapp-1.0.0/login.dohttp://www.MYAPP.se/MYAPP-webapp-1.0.0/login.action
...I just get the above 404.http://www.MYAPP.se/MYAPP-webapp-1.0.0/login.jsp of course work.
So if you guys got any ideas or anything I could ask the webhotel-support-guys to look for please let me know.Any ideas are most welcomeBest regardsFredrik

Hello guys!
I started my tomcat at home with catalina.bat start -security.
During startup I at once got a lot of exceptions, please see this pastie:http://pastie.org/8499210
When I try to access the webapp I get 404 right away.At the production server I at least could access the jsp:s direct, but through struts I got 404.Now at home I just get 404 in both ways.
One interesting thing is that it looks like the app do not got permissions to load the struts-default.xml:
Caused by: Caught exception while loading file struts-default.xml
...that could be the same issue in production since no struts is working at all.
I have not worked with permissions before but examing the catalina.policy with polycytool I see there is alot of settings like:java.util.PropertyPermission java.vm.version read...that I guess means that it is OK to read the System.getProperty("java.vm.version");
If you draw any conclusion about my app like is there any permission I need to set to make it work (I guess it must be able to read struts-default.xml for eg), please let me know. 
Then I will get in contact with the webhotel-support and try to ask them to tell me if they got that permission-settings.

The message is that java.lang.SecurityManager.checkPermission()  was
called with a wrong argument. The code that makes that call is

> ognl.OgnlRuntime.invokeMethod(OgnlRuntime.java:834)

That is not Tomcat code. You should ask the authors of that OGNL
library (and check whether you use the latest version of it). They are
making that call with wrong arguments.


The rest is from my general knowledge. Usually the calls to
"checkPermission()" are performed only when you run with Java's
SecurityManager being enabled.  Try to enable it when you are running
at home and see whether the error reproduces itself. (Or try to
disable it in your production configuration and see how the error goes
away).

http://tomcat.apache.org/tomcat-6.0-doc/security-manager-howto.html
